CVE-2024-1439
Inadequate access control in Moodle LMS. This vulnerability could allow a local user with a student role to create arbitrary events intended for users with higher roles. It could also allow the attacker to add events to the calendar of all users without their prior consent...
CVE-2021-36400
In Moodle, insufficient capability checks made it possible to remove other users' calendar URL subscriptions...
